step 1: Create A Digitizing Plan
Decide which shapes to trace first – look at the image and think of it as layers. Trace the layers in back first. Trace the shapes that should stitch first and leave the details for last.

Digitizing Plan:
Here is a suggested digitizing plan for you to follow:
1-green leaves
- trace the shapes using the Fill stitch tool
- edit the shapes as needed
- TIP: trace each leaf in TWO sections to create more interest
2-dk red leaves
- trace the shapes using the Fill stitch tool
- edit the shapes as needed
- TIP: trace each left separately to give more definition to the flower
3-med red leaves
- trace the shapes using the Fill stitch tool
- edit the shapes as needed
- TIP: trace each left separately to give more definition to the flower
4-flower center
- trace the shape using the Fill stitch tool
- edit the shape as needed
- TIP: in the properties box, change the Fill type to a motif or fancy fill pattern
5-center dots
- trace one shape using the artwork circle tool
- convert the circle to a Satin stitch using the Auto Satin tool on the bottom toolbar
- copy and paste to the other dots
